Syllabus

Course Objectives

At the end of the course, students will be able to:

understand a complex social field through qualitative methods, i.e. read and develop a short ethnographic field;

analyze and interpret the visual digital languages used to describe complex social fields;

navigate critically through visual narrations related to tourism experiences.


Course Prerequisites

General background knowledge of social sciences theory.


Teaching Methods

Lesson with support of visuals and slides. Digital tools wil be used to develop interactivity.


Assessment Methods

Oral exam on the contents of the course.

For attending students: il will be possibile to develop an in-class execise on visual digital languages

that might replace partially or totally the oral exam.


Contents

The course is organized in two sections.


Section 1 deals with qualitative methodology of social reserach.

Drawing upon historic examples and exemplary case studies, ethnographic

and open interview methodologies are presented and explained in depth.


Section 2 deals with the interplay between visual anthropology and tourism,

with a focus on the producion of digital visual contents in multiple tourism

contexts (Norway, India, Italy). The course discusses the relation between formal

and informally produced digital visual narratives.
